June 29 - July 5: Three Storefronts in One Week
This week, the storefront is home to three events, each presented by a local artist: a book release, an art show, and a rummage sale to support a Fringe Festival show being rehearsed in the space. Come to one, come to them all!

July 3: "ENTWINED" Fundraisin' Rummage Sale
Saturday, July 3: all day
Amy Salloway - creator of the hit touring one-woman theatre productions "Does This Monologue Make Me Look Fat?", "So Kiss Me Already, Herschel Gertz!" and "Circumference" - will be using Storefront-in-a-Box to develop and rehearse a new show, "Entwined", for the 2010 MN Fringe Festival, opening August 5th, 2010. Rehearsals aren't exactly open to the public, but folks are welcome to stop by and offer encouragement, AND to come to the "ENTWINED" fundraisin' rummage sale in front of the store all day on Saturday, July 3rd! All proceeds will go to the show's production costs.
"Entwined" is the mostly-true tale of a dubious romance that meets its final end on a road trip to the World's Biggest Ball of Twine. Tangling together "now" and "before", live music and narration, the show is a celebration of loneliness, a high-five to the Dorky and Desperate. August 10-16: Art Swap in a Box
The Art Swap Shanty debuted in January, 2010, as part of the Art Shanty Projects on Medicine Lake outside of Minneapolis, MN. Our shanty consisted of a tiny shack with a giant hat, complete with a giant pom. Underneath the hat, 799 people arrived with their Art, leaving it behind in our gallery and taking someone else's art home. All the swaps are documented at iceartswap.com. It's clear from people's faces that Swapping Art Improves Lives!
This summer the Pom heads to Mpls where it will amuse you as you join us on Lyndale Avenue to swap your art for someone elses's! This swap will be slightly different from the ice swap, and will culminate in a Swap Gala, a grand reception under the Pom.
